Based on the following historical data, determine the optimal order quantity, safety stock, and reorder point for a perpetual system
cost of placing an order = $29
annual carrying charge = 17%
warehouse capacity = 1000 units
value of an item = $400
annual demand for the item = 2475 units
number of operating days in a year = 360
stockout cost per unit = $29
average lead time = 8 days
standard deviation of lead time = 4 days
standard deviation of daily demand = 3 units
distribution of demand during lead time = normal
Briefly explain how this system would work in a company
